Elizabeth taught 15 days ago
The Student and Tutor conducted a piano lesson focusing on practicing two pieces: "Dancing Kangaroo" and a new, more challenging piece. They worked on improving hands-together coordination, note recognition, and understanding key signatures, with a strong emphasis on consistent practice. The Student is expected to continue practicing the covered material.

Grace taught 25 days ago
The Student and Tutor engaged in a piano lesson, focusing on technique and music theory. They practiced scales, worked on a technique piece, discussed musical notation concepts like flats, sharps, rolled chords, and pedal usage. New concepts such as key signatures and tied notes were introduced and practiced through various short pieces, with the Student encouraged to continue practicing the current page.

Ana taught about 1 month ago
The Student and Tutor engaged in a piano lesson, practicing a two-hand coordination warm-up exercise across scales and working on F major arpeggios. They also reviewed and practiced sections of the songs "Desperado" and "Take it to the Limit." The Tutor advised the Student to continue practicing the warm-up exercise and arpeggios slowly, focusing on individual scales and parts.

Dylan taught about 2 months ago
The Student and Tutor reviewed music notation, focusing on understanding note durations, rhythmic values, and timing within musical bars. They practiced identifying and interpreting different note types, rests, ties, and slurs to improve rhythmic accuracy. The Tutor advised the student to practice challenging sections slowly and accurately.
